Output 8d3b578a86a4583a28a983444d8d6e67c6edcf007ff299fcdbaddde7c5bf3ba9:14

value
10038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8032b8808571e7bcd2fa225105504f47642e133d OP_EQUAL
address
3DNsBEaEtiapjEtPpqDF36tixRyd2dMyWq
transaction
8d3b578a86a4583a28a983444d8d6e67c6edcf007ff299fcdbaddde7c5bf3ba9
spent
true